/r9k/ is a board with no reposts.
Rules/observations/etc:
1. If you attempt to post something unoriginal, it is not posted.
2. In this case you are muted temporarily.
3. The time with which you are muted for increases with each transgression.
4. Each mute time is 2^n (thanks, mathsfags) in seconds where n is the number of times you have transgressed. So, your mute time is the amount of fuck ups you have made to the power of two, in seconds.
5. Quotes, eg >>1, are not viewed by R9K. So "lolwut" and ">>2 lolwut" are the same post, in the eyes on R9K.
6. Gibberish at the end of a post to force originality is punished with the full force of the banhammer. Even testing R9K's parameters seems to draw the ire of the mods.
6(2). Images are included. Slight changes in exif data, etc, however, seem to circumvent this rule, but like with text if you break the filter the REAL LIVE MODS will banhammer you.
8. Your mute count never resets or goes backwards.
9. You cannot post a picture without text.
10. You cannot impersonate moot.
11. Unicode is blocked. Sorry, too many exploits (Cyrillic letters, etc)
12. The too low in content filter was broken for a while, resulting in a lot of crappy mutes. Sorry.
13. Post sane, real content, well thought out replies, and mutes are unlikely.

Randall Munroe made a post once back a long time ago about his "success" with this idea in a xkcd chatroom.
He said that it was better than all other forms of moderation for large groups on the internet, or as I said, a success.
But it quite obviously isn't.
And he doesn't even discuss the whole "repetition is how things evolve" deal, he seems to think the biggest problem is that you can't say "Yeah.".

He also doesn't dicuss the fact thta if yu mspel thangfs that udder ppl hav sayd than its stil counted az nu.
Which isn't as big of a problem, but is an inherent flaw in the text based word-filter version we're talking about.
